Title: Diwakar N Tundlam: Innovator in Power Management Systems
Introduction
Diwakar N Tundlam is a notable inventor based in Cupertino, CA (US). He has made significant contributions to the field of power management systems, particularly in optimizing power usage for computer systems. His innovative approach has led to the development of a unique patent that addresses the challenges of varying power usage adaptability among clients.
Latest Patents
Diwakar holds a patent for a "Coherent power management system for managing clients of varying power usage adaptability." This patent outlines systems and methods for allocating and distributing power management budgets for subsystems, such as power usage clients, within a computer system. The invention includes a power budget allocation subsystem that features multiple feedback branches with different associated time constants. Clients with slower power response times receive power budgets based on feedback branches with longer time constants, while those with faster response times are allocated budgets based on branches with shorter time constants. This innovative approach allows for more efficient power management tailored to the specific needs of each client.
